BES Sodium Salt Product Analysis
BES Sodium Salt, also known as 2-[Bis(2-hydroxyethyl)amino]ethanesulfonic acid sodium salt, is a zwitterionic buffering agent renowned for its high buffering capacity and stability across a wide pH range (pH 7.0-7.6). Its primary advantage lies in its minimal interaction with biological macromolecules, making it ideal for life science applications. Innovations in synthesis have led to the availability of ultra-pure grades (greater than 99%) crucial for sensitive genomic and proteomic research, as well as for biopharmaceutical manufacturing. Its application extends beyond biological buffers to include water-based paint formulations, where it acts as a pH stabilizer and dispersant, enhancing product performance and shelf-life.
